AC Milan chief Galliani concedes Kaka return unlikely

AC Milan vice-president Adriano Galliani believes the prospect of re-signing Real Madrid midfielder Kaka is a non-starter.

There have been numerous reports that the Rossoneri want to bring Kaka back from Real Madrid, including statements from Galliani and President Silvio Berlusconi.

"Unfortunately Kaka will not return and the reasons are economic ones," Vice-President Galliani told the Gazzetta dello Sport.

"Roma will probably buy out Marco Borriello, while there's absolutely no truth in talks for Cristiano Ronaldo or Michael Essien.

"Mario Balotelli to Milan? I doubt it."
